The following may apply for a cycle of studies conferring a Doctoral degree:
a) Holders of a Master's degree or legal equivalent;
b) Holders of a Bachelor's degree with a relevant academic or scientific curriculum recognized by the Scientific Committee as attesting to their ability to attend this cycle of studies;
c) Those with an academic, scientific or professional curriculum recognized by the Scientific Committee as attesting to their ability to attend this cycle of studies.
The Scientific Committee of each programme may determine what previous qualifications are to be considered, restricting or detailing the general requirements (please see information for each programme).

N.B.:
1 – The Numerus Clausus available are shown in the table above. The numerus clausus remaining from each phase will be added to the ones available in the next phase.
Other phases planned in calendar and for which there aren't vacancies initially planned, will be held only if there are vacancies left over from previous phases.

N.B.:
1- In Phase 1, only applicants with application grades higher than 14 (out of 20)* will be ranked. They must also provide documentary evidence proving they have the qualifications necessary to apply.
2 – Candidates who have completed or are expected to complete the programme before the applications deadline*, will be accepted in subsequent phases. If they cannot obtain the Graduation Certificate, a Declaration of Honour stating they have completed the necessary qualifications required must be produced.
The registration will only be considered valid upon presentation of the Graduation Certificate.
* Except for programmes that establish other admission requirements.
(1) Notes for Applicants from foreign higher education:
For qualifications obtained abroad you will be required to produce an original document in either Portuguese, English, French or Spanish, duly signed and certified by the respective institution’s highest academic body.
If the document is not translated into one of the above mentioned languages then it must be authenticated by the official education authorities of the respective country and recognized by the Portuguese consular or diplomatic authorities. Alternatively, it must hold the Apostille of the Hague Convention. The same should happen with regard to translations of documents whose original language is not Spanish, French or English.
In addition to these, you may be required to produce other documents depending on the programme you are applying to (information available in the application process).
Candidates will only be allowed to enroll after producing all required documents.
The applicant is required to pay a 55 euro non-refundable fee.
